Who is Hawk Tuah Girl?
Haliey Welch, a 22-year-old from Belfast, Tennessee, went viral in June 2024 after a YouTube video by Tim & Dee TV captured her saying “hawk tuah” in a street interview. The phrase, mimicking a spitting sound, became a meme, gaining millions of views on TikTok. Welch quit her spring factory job and built a brand that includes:
- A merchandise line earning over $65,000 in early sales.
- A podcast, “Talk Tuah,” ranking in Spotify’s top five.
- Over 2.6 million Instagram followers and paid appearances, like throwing the first pitch at a Mets game.
Her Southern charm made her a Gen Z icon, but her crypto venture brought challenges.

What Was $HAWK?
In December 2024, Welch launched $HAWK, a meme coin on the Solana blockchain, with web3 developer overHere Limited. Meme coins are cryptocurrencies inspired by internet trends, like Dogecoin, often driven by hype rather than utility. Welch promoted $HAWK on X and her podcast, aiming to connect with fans and give free tokens to supporters.
The launch was volatile:
- Peak: $HAWK hit a $490 million market cap within hours.
- Crash: It dropped 95% to $60 million in 20 minutes, later stabilizing at $28 million by December 5, 2024, per DEX Screener.

How Much Did Haliey Welch Make?
Welch’s earnings from $HAWK are not fully public, but reports provide clues:
- Upfront Payment: She received $125,000 to promote $HAWK.
- Token Share: Welch owned 10% of $HAWK tokens, locked for one year with a three-year vesting period, meaning she couldn’t sell during the crash.
- Insider Profits: Blockchain firm Bubblemaps reported insiders made $3 million, but no evidence confirms Welch was included. One wallet flipped 17.5% of tokens for $1.3 million.
- Net Worth: As of 2025, Welch’s net worth is around $500,000, from:
- Merchandise: $65,000+.
- Podcast sponsorships and appearances: Tens of thousands.
- Social media deals: Similar range.
- $HAWK: Likely limited to the $125,000 payment.
| Income Source | Estimated Earnings |
|---|---|
| Merchandise Sales | $65,000+ |
| Podcast (“Talk Tuah”) | Tens of thousands |
| Social Media Deals | Tens of thousands |
| Public Appearances | Tens of thousands |
| $HAWK Cryptocurrency | $125,000 (confirmed) |
| Total Net Worth | ~$500,000 (2025) |
Welch denied selling tokens, stating on X, “Team hasn’t sold one token,” though a community note questioned this.

Why the Controversy?
The $HAWK crash fueled accusations:
- Pump-and-Dump Claims: Crypto investigator Coffeezilla accused Welch’s team of hyping the coin for insider profits. Bubblemaps found 96% of tokens in one wallet cluster, suggesting coordinated sales.
- Lawsuits: On December 19, 2024, investors sued overHere Limited, its founder Clinton So, and others in New York federal court, alleging $151,000 in losses. Welch was not named as a defendant.
- SEC Probe: The SEC investigated but closed the case in March 2025, finding no charges against Welch.
- Welch’s Response: She cooperated with investors’ lawyers, expressed regret, and paused her podcast, saying the controversy “hurt my feelings”.

Lessons from $HAWK
Welch’s crypto venture offers takeaways:
- Meme Coin Risks: These coins are volatile and often lack value beyond hype.
- Celebrity Ventures: Fame doesn’t guarantee crypto success, as seen with Kim Kardashian’s SEC fines.
- Investor Caution: Research projects thoroughly before investing.
Welch moved forward by:
- Relaunching her podcast in 2025.
- Starting Pookie Tools, a dating advice app, in November 2024.
- Founding an animal charity to rebuild her image.

FAQs
How much did Hawk Tuah Girl make from $HAWK?
Welch earned $125,000 upfront, but her 10% token share was locked, so no crash profits are confirmed.
What is $HAWK worth now?
As of December 2024, $HAWK’s market cap is ~$28 million, per DEX Screener.
Was $HAWK a scam?
No evidence proves Welch scammed investors, and the SEC cleared her, but insider trading claims persist.
What is Hawk Tuah Girl’s net worth?
Around $500,000 in 2025, from merchandise, podcast, and social media.
Why do meme coins crash?
They rely on hype, and rapid selling by early investors can tank prices.
